Facility Inspections
While this place's overall grade was as bad as it gets, it actually didn't perform terribly in the area of inspections. In fact, we awarded it a B- for that category, which is one of our better scores. Our inspection grades account for several factors found on a nursing home's inspection report. One key criteria we weigh heavily is the quantity and severity of deficiencies. Fortunately, although this nursing home had some minor dings on its inspection report, it had no severe deficiencies. Severe deficiencies are those found in categories G, H, I, J, K and L. This tells you the government inspectors didn't deem any of the deficiencies on this facility's report to pose an imminent threat to patient safety or health. A few minor deficiencies aren't the end of the world.
Short-term Care Quality
This nursing home wound up receiving a an abysmal grade in our short-term care area. It received an F in this area. Short-term care scores are meaningful for prospective residents requiring rehabilitation. Rehabilitation usually mandates additional highly-skilled nursing services. Skilled nursing includes a broad scope of nursing services, spanning from registered nurses to physical and speech therapists, as well as other types of therapy. Based on its grade in this area, we weren't surprised to discover that this nursing home is well below average in terms of the quantity of physical therapy and registered nurse hours provided to its patients based on the measures we looked at. Finally, we looked at the percentage of residents who were able to return home from this facility. This facility didn't fare well here either. In fact, we found that just 0 percent of this facility's residents were able to return home. This figure was well off the national average.

Nurse Quality
In addition, we gave this facility an F in the area of nursing care. Our nursing grade includes several factors, but the main consideration is the level of nurse hours spent with patients. This nursing home provides 0.2 hours of nursing care per resident per day. This is a much lower figure than we are used to seeing. Finally, we also assessed some nursing quality measures in determining our nursing scores. This facility fared well in terms of avoiding pressure ulcers and major falls. We consider these datapoints to be good indicators of the quality of nursing care.
Long-term Care Quality
The final category we rated is long-term care. Sadly, it received a lowly F in this category, which is an abysmal score. In a long-term care environment, the facility's primary goal is to keep patients as healthy and safe as possible. This is different than skilled nursing or short-term care where the goal is to rehabilitate residents. One of the data points we considered in addition to nursing hours is vaccinations. Fortunately, this facility administered the pneumonia vaccination to 96.03025 percent of its residents. To our surprise, this nursing home was able to limit hospitalizations. With just 0 hospitalizations per 1,000 long-term resident days, this nursing home had fewer hospitalizations than many nursing homes. Sadly, a few of its other scores in this category weren't as favorable as these.
